Title: Source region, damping, and seismological application of 3-minute slow waves propagating along umbral fan loops

Abstract: Coronal fan loops rooted in sunspot umbra constantly show 3-minute period propagating slow magnetoacoustic waves in the corona. Since these loops are not visible in the lower atmosphere, the origin of these waves in the lower solar atmosphere is still unclear. In this talk, we will demonstrate a novel observational technique to trace the origin of these waves at the photosphere from the corona to the photosphere via the transition region and chromosphere. Tracing of these loops also provides observational evidence of cross-sectional area expansion of the loops from the photosphere to the corona. This information is further utilized to study the actual damping of slow waves and estimation of magnetic fields and plasma-beta along umbral loops. In summary, we will present the source region, propagation, damping, and seismological application of 3-minute slow waves from the photosphere to the corona along umbral fan loops.
